iPad1,iOS5.1.1带redsn0w的越狱软件,工作非常好,但自从安装了inetutils后,网络超时。如何调整/修复?

iPad1,iOS5.1.1带redsn0w的越狱软件,工作非常好,但自从安装了inetutils后,网络超时。如何调整/修复?,ipad,networking,jailbreak,ios5.1,Ipad,Networking,Jailbreak,Ios5.1,我用redsn0w在旧iPad1上进行了越狱。他工作得很好。安装了OpenSSH,我可以使用Windows上的Putty或Linux上的SSH登录到我的iPad,当然,还可以使用pscp或scp在Windows或Linux上迁移文件。安装了DOSbox(使用DOSpad.deb文件),并且工作正常。但是基本越狱版本上没有“ping”,所以我安装了“inetutils”,它提供了所有GNU inet内容(ping、ftp、inetd、rlogin、telnet),然后在网络命令中找到了“arp i

我用redsn0w在旧iPad1上进行了越狱。他工作得很好。安装了OpenSSH,我可以使用Windows上的Putty或Linux上的SSH登录到我的iPad,当然,还可以使用pscp或scp在Windows或Linux上迁移文件。安装了DOSbox(使用DOSpad.deb文件),并且工作正常。但是基本越狱版本上没有“ping”,所以我安装了“inetutils”,它提供了所有GNU inet内容(ping、ftp、inetd、rlogin、telnet),然后在网络命令中找到了“arp iconfig netstat route traceroute”。这使得旧平板电脑非常非常有用。非常好的东西,但我现在注意到iPad的网络访问时间过得很快。这是自Cydia“inetutils”安装以来的新行为。如果我放下iPad,几分钟后,我就无法从局域网上的任何机器上ping它。我可以,在我安装网络实用程序之前。也许是安全功能?如果是这样的话,我可以退出网络,只需要ssh访问,并且不超时吗?我想一直“活着”。好的,找到了。当你越狱的时候。1,运行iOS 5.1.1,使用Redsn0w,提供root访问的代码的初始安装不包括标准inetutils。iPad1最初的行为是,如果配置了静态ip值,这意味着如果打开,并且启用了wifi,即使屏幕处于“休眠”状态,它也会响应“ping”

此ping响应用于诊断目的。越狱代码的初始安装并没有改变这种行为。但我无法从iPad“ping”到其他机器,因为即使在越狱后也没有ping.exe可用(这与黑莓Playbook形成对比,后者有一个“ping”实用程序,即使“睡着”也会响应ping)

所以我从Cydia source Telesphoreo下载了“inetutils”软件包,它提供了一个ping.exe,可以在iPad的控制台模式下使用。它运行良好,是一个非常有用的程序

但是,如果你把iPad放在一边,大约5分钟后,它就会超时。wifi传输功能似乎刚刚关闭,对“ping”的响应被明确禁用

经过大量研究和实验,我确定可以通过发送SSH查询远程重新激活iPad的“ping”响应。例如:

[你的_id@Linbox~]$sshmobile@xxx.yyy.zzz.aaa

其中xxx.yyy.zzz.aaa是您的IPV4地址, 假设您已将iPad配置为静态ip值。(我拥有两个C级ip系列,因此我在工作中已经使用了很多年)。越狱后定义的两个用户标识是“mobile”和“root”

从Telesphoreo源存储库下载并安装所有较新的“inetutils”实用程序和“Network Commands”实用程序后,会出现新的行为

这种行为改变实际上是一个很好的主意,因为它阻止了ping的不当使用,并且可能还节省了电池寿命。但这是一个改变,从以前的运作特点。另一位同事也进入了这个兔子洞,并在“jailbreakqa.com”网站上记录了解决方案,网址如下:

希望这些信息有用。

很想看到这个问题被否决。。Lemmie说,让这个旧iPad作为一个成熟的远程可访问Linux设备运行是非常有用的。一旦越狱,你就可以来回使用scp文件,在本地安装自定义计算代码,基本上把你的办公室都放在一个小公文包里的一块小巧轻便的平板电脑上。最有用。

非常有趣的帖子。。。这正是我要找的。我用ipad1/16g/3G在厨房墙上显示domotica信息。这工作得很好,使用ssh我可以让它打开、显示一些内容并关闭。 我给自己买了另一台ipad,只有1/16gb的wifi,而这台有睡眠wifi问题。我的第一个想法是它与3g芯片有关。。也许这能让ipad在另一个睡觉的时候保持活力。3G机型没有安装inetutils,仍然无法进入睡眠状态。因此,我的思路似乎有一些妙处。 我将inetutils安装在只支持wifi的ipad上,似乎解决了这个问题。我能很好地适应它。。即使它处于睡眠模式。谢谢你的更新。
你帖子中的链接不再有效

您的问题与安装inetutils无关-它只是一堆可执行文件。听起来你的iPad好像刚刚进入睡眠状态。如果您将任何iOS设备的屏幕关闭几分钟,它将关闭WiFi并进入睡眠状态。因为它一直都是“活的”,所以你必须安装特殊的软件,比如失眠。Thx作为响应,是的,我熟悉inetutils。我的关键点是,在我为越狱iPad安装Cydia软件包版本的inetutils之前,网络访问没有进入睡眠状态。当然,屏幕会休眠,但iPad会保持网络感知,只要它通电并开机。在我从Cydia source repo“Telesphoreo”安装inetutils后,这种行为发生了变化。如果我查询“ifconfig en0”,我注意到其中一个参数是“SMART”。我怀疑这可能就是问题所在。我希望有原始的行为,设备始终保持网络感知。我描述了原始的行为-它应该像你描述的那样进入睡眠状态。如果您自己没有更改任何内容,inetutils无法通过安装来更改这些内容。这已经是正常的行为了。你可能只是以前没注意到而已。但不管怎样,你描述的是iOS设备的完全正常行为,不管它们是否越狱。下载失眠症或类似的东西来解决它,没有其他解决办法。我不想粗鲁,但这是不对的。也许你不熟悉当一个人运行